Detailed explanation-1: -Japan was a part of the Axis powers during the second world war and not a part of the Allied countries.

Detailed explanation-2: -The Axis Powers were the coalition led by Germany, Italy, and Japan during World War II.

Detailed explanation-3: -Answer and Explanation: Japan joined the Axis powers because it had ambitions to build an empire in the Pacific. This made the United States and Great Britain, the two most powerful empires in the Pacific besides Japan, Japan’s natural enemies.

Detailed explanation-4: -Japan participated in World War I from 1914 to 1918 in an alliance with Entente Powers and played an important role in securing the sea lanes in the West Pacific and Indian Oceans against the Imperial German Navy as a member of the Allies.

Detailed explanation-5: -The main Axis powers were Germany, Japan and Italy. The Axis leaders were Adolf Hitler (Germany), Benito Mussolini (Italy), and Emperor Hirohito (Japan).
